Analysis
Curaçao recorded 203 1000 USD for wrapping papers — import value in 2024.
The figure is up 5.2% on the previous year and down 1.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, wrapping papers — import value in Curaçao peaked at 207 1000 USD in 2011 and was at its lowest, 56 1000 USD, in 2021.
That places Curaçao 172nd out of 219 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 14 years of available data.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
